 Project objective

The aim of SMITH innovation project is to design, develop, test under real life conditions and commercialise a novel product consisting of a Smart and Interoperable Thermal Network for micro-industrial based on biomass sources. Unique Value Proposition of the product is based on: 1) provide industrial parks with the opportunity to reduce energy costs by promoting the cascade use and the highest efficient management of the heating infrastructure; 2) combine the centralised management of the system with an application for real time decision-making of the final users (including real time consumption, invoicing, decisions about the different temperature level options, head demand planning, etc); 3) clearly foresee and plan before every product deployment the needed investment and infrastructure in order to assess the technical feasibility and profitability for both the consortium & customers; 4) design financial schemes based on energy service contracting that will avoid the industries to make investments for the new infrastructures; and, 5) reduce GHG emissions by using renewable energies in industrial networks, most of them located close to urban areas. The SMITH strength vs natural gas source are: stable and lower price, better efficiency, more sustainable and flexible, high adaptation capacity to match consumption peaks vs users’ demand, better energy and temperatures management, high control of industrial process, and stop and go more resourceful. The Feasibility Study will be focus on: a) assess the EU market needs in relation to the concrete product; b) select the countries with the best conditions to start the commercialisation of the product, and draft the business strategy for each country; c) profiling of customers in the target countries; d) obtain a direct feedback from consumers through a product concept testing; and, e) set all the critical variables needed for the go-to-market decision, the business plan and for the customer validation in Phase 2.
